Local design build team Sarah Gallop Design Inc. recently won the Best New Kitchen under $100,000 at the Greater Vancouver Home Builders' Association 2016 Ovation Awards.

The annual awards recognize excellence in renovation, new home construction and design in Metro Vancouver.

"The issues around affordability and densification are actually great drivers for builders, developers and renovators looking at new ideas, and push the building envelope with leading-edge, awardwinning solutions. It's an exciting time for housing choice in Vancouver" said Bob de Wit, CEO of the GVHBA.

Island Express Air this week announced the addition of Comox Airport to its roster.

Starting May 16, the airline will offer daily service between Comox and Boundary Bay Airport, Abbotsford and Victoria.

Island Express began operating out of Boundary Bay in March 2014.

Starting in 2009 with just two aircraft, the company now has six planes.

The Globe and Mail recently named Deltabased LMI Technologies one of the 50 top medium-sized workplaces in Canada.

LMI, a leading developer of 3D scanning and inspection solutions, earned its spot on the list by offering employees flexible work schedules with telecommuting options, competitive health care benefits, a weekly hot lunch buffet and sponsoring employee development. LMI employees also receive financial incentives in the form of a companywide profit-sharing bonus program.

The company also has a policy of transparency and engagement supported by regular town hall meetings with CEO Terry Arden.
